Transaction 50540c567771212ff2c09391e0f6f265224cbddf17fd948229587572309c4a93

1 Input
2 Outputs
  • 50540c567771212ff2c09391e0f6f265224cbddf17fd948229587572309c4a93:0
  • value  43968052469
    address  3Cqy9kDgfducNz3r2kkczyA3igPo25Agk2
  • 50540c567771212ff2c09391e0f6f265224cbddf17fd948229587572309c4a93:1
  • value  100000
    address  15wicbBdPzxBaNgkeLsk1h6GwBUP8WpmLF